Cannot find the Hirez Installation
I get this message when I try to play the game. What does this even mean, and how do I fix this?

Some users have found that this helps:

With the launcher open, try running the Diagnostic Tool (Settings, Troubleshoot) and run a validate and repair. If this doesn’t fix the issue we recommend uninstalling from Steam, and reinstalling.

If this doesn't work, you can also try to run the installhirezservice.exe found in your steam directory under \steamapps\common\SMITE\Binaries\Redist.
